What is Vai (VAI)?

Vai is a decentralized stablecoin that operates on the Binance Smart Chain (BSC). It is pegged to the value of the US dollar, which means that its value is meant to remain stable in comparison to the dollar. This makes Vai an attractive investment option for traders looking for a stable investment.

One of the key features of Vai is that it is algorithmic, meaning that it is backed by a mathematical formula instead of physical assets like traditional stablecoins. The algorithm ensures that the supply of Vai remains stable and that its value remains pegged to the US dollar.

How does Vai work?

Vai is minted when users deposit collateral in the form of Binance Coin (BNB) or other supported cryptocurrencies. The deposited collateral is then used to generate Vai tokens through the algorithmic formula, which calculates the amount of Vai to be minted based on the value of the collateral deposited.

Once the Vai tokens are generated, they can be used for various purposes, including trading, borrowing, or providing liquidity on the Binance Smart Chain. Additionally, Vai can also be redeemed for the underlying collateral at any time.

What are the benefits of using Vai?

One of the key benefits of using Vai is its stability. As a decentralized stablecoin, Vai is designed to remain pegged to the value of the US dollar, which means that it is less volatile than other cryptocurrencies.

Vai also offers several other benefits, including fast transaction times, low fees, and the ability to earn interest through staking. Additionally, because Vai operates on the Binance Smart Chain, it can be used to access various DeFi applications and other blockchain-based services.
